Admissions and Assessment
Walk-ins are accepted during business hours with no appointment required. Clients must be 18 or over and showing active signs of withdrawal so clinicians can determine the appropriate medication dosage. On clients’ first day, the medical team will perform an assessment of substance use and health history, as well as routine bloodwork and urinalysis. If medically cleared, staff will administer the first stabilizing dose of MAT. Clients also meet with a counselor to establish goals and learn program guidelines.
Flexible Take-Home Medication Options
Clients who meet certain criteria in their recovery process can become eligible to bring doses of their prescribed medications home with them. This flexibility is a benefit for clients managing childcare, job obligations, and other responsibilities. Eligibility is determined on a case-by-case basis through a structured system that tracks factors such as scheduled meeting attendance, behavior, and safety.

Commission on Accreditation of Rehabilitation Facilities
CARF reviews rehab programs to make sure they provide respectful, effective, and personalized care. For addiction treatment, CARF uses standards developed with the American Society of Addiction Medicine (ASAM), so this accreditation shows the program follows trusted, evidence-based guidelines for treating substance use.
Learn moreSAMHSA-certified Opioid Treatment Program
This is a federal certification for programs that offer medication like methadone or buprenorphine to treat opioid addiction. It means the center is legally approved to provide this care, follows strict safety rules, and combines medication with counseling to support long-term recovery.
